This college is under central government.
Placements: 100% students get placements. It's not a private college so it's all about rank during CET examination. Top recruiting companies are Wipro technologies, Whirlpool India Ltd., VIP Industries Ltd and Trident Group.
Infrastructure: The course is good as it has too many opportunities. Wi-Fi, labs, classrooms and ACs are available. Our department has everything which is needed for a particular department. Hostel is very clean and good. Hostel facilities are too good. They have a personal Gym in the hostel, Hall room, TV hall, dinning, and good quality of food is available.
Faculty: Most of the teachers are doctors, Professors and they are Ph.D. qualified. They are very friendly and helpful. The course makes students industry ready. It has two Internal exams and one External exam. Exams are quite tough & the college is very concerned about it. 50% is the pass percentage.

National institute for locomotor disabilities review.
Placements: The placement is perfect. Now a day there is awareness of rehabilitation. Many multinational clinics like Otto Bock Endolite bionic and government organisation like Alimco is coming for placement. Many private clinics like Apollo Narayana are also coming for placements.
Infrastructure: The infrastructure is good. Well-decorated classrooms with air conditioning. The hostel is too good and a play ground is there. A gain library present with a full fill of all types of books and international magazines. There will be a radiology lab, pathology lab, and a pharmacy there.
Faculty: The faculty here are well experienced. Patients are coming from all over India just because of central government organisations. Exams are conducted by the West Bengal University of Health Science.
Other: There are freshers and an annual fest programme conducted every year. Annual sports day is also held once a year.

    The fee structure of the Bachelor of Physiotherapy (BPT) course at National Institute for Locomotor Disabilities (Divyangjan), Kolkata:

    Rs 61,000 First Year

    2nd to 4th years: Rs. 40,750 per year
